Microsoft and TSMC gain buy ratings due to strong AI-driven growth, while AMD’s valuation tempers enthusiasm despite its rally.

Analysts upgraded Microsoft (MSFT) and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ing (TSM) to buy ratings, citing robust AI-driven performance. Microsoft trades at a P/E of 28, supported by Azure’s 43% growth and $90.01 billion in Q4 revenue, while TSMC reported a 77% surge in net income last quarter.

Microsoft’s Azure crossed $100 billion in annual revenue, with commercial remaining performance obligations (RPO) hitting $678 billion, up 84%. TSMC’s leading-edge foundry position strengthens its role in the AI supply chain. AMD, trading at a trailing P/E of 124 after a 119% year-to-date rally, was rated a hold due to valuation concerns.

The three companies represent distinct layers of the AI stack: hyperscale cloud, semiconductor manufacturing, and merchant accelerators. Analyst targets for Microsoft average $563.84, reflecting confidence in its growth trajectory.
